Speech and Language Pathologist Assistant
Bandera, TXMarch 20th, 2026
Position Type:Student Support Services/Speech and Language PathologistDate Posted:6/19/2025Location:Central OfficeDate Available:ImmediateClosing Date:Open Until FilledBandera ISD is looking for a qualified SLP Assistant for the 2025-2026 school year.Bandera ISD currently practices a 4-Day Instructional Week (Monday-Thursday)Full time positionStart Date: ImmediatePrimary Purpose:Provide speech-language pathology services to students as directed by a supervising Texas licensed Speech-Language Pathologist licensed by (TDLR).Qualifications:Bachelor's degree in communicative science and disordersTexas license as Speech-Language Pathology AssistantSpecial Knowledge/Skills:Strong communication, organizational, and interpersonal skillsKnowledge of speech-language disorders and conditionsPreferred Experience:Fifty hours of clinical observation and assisting experience as required for licensureMajor Responsibilities and Duties:Therapy:1. Conduct speech, language, and hearing screening as directed by the supervising licensed speech-language pathologist.2. Implement the treatment program or the individual education plan (IEP) as designed by the supervisinglicensed speech-language pathologist.3. Conduct carry-over activities to transfer a student's newly acquired communication ability to othercontexts and situations.4. Represent speech pathology at the admission, review, and dismissal (ARD) Committee as directed bythe supervising speech-language pathologist.5. Conduct observations and prepare clinical materials.Consultation6. Work with classroom teachers to implement classroom activities to improve communication skillsof students.Student Management:7. Create an environment conducive to learning and appropriate for maturity level and interests ofstudents.8. Establish control and administer discipline according to the Student Code of Conduct and studenthandbook.Program Management9. Compile, maintain, and file all reports, records, and other documents required including maintainingclinical records in accordance with federal and state laws and regulations.10. Comply with policies established by federal and state laws, State Board of Education rule, and boardpolicy. Comply with all district and campus routines and regulations.11. Maintain required documentation of services and enter SHARS billing for students who receiveMedicaid.Other:12. Other duties as assigned as per the needs of the school district.Mental Demands/Physical Demands/Environmental Factors:Tools/Equipment Used: Standard testing equipment; standard office equipment including computer andperipheralsPosture: Frequent sitting, kneeling/squatting, bending/stooping, pushing/pulling, and twistingMotion: Frequent walking, grasping/squeezing, wrist flexion/extensionLifting: Regular light lifting and carrying (under 15 pounds), occasional heaving lifting (45 pounds or more)and positioning of students with physical disabilities; controlling behavior through physical restraint; assistingnon-ambulatory studentsEnvironment: Exposure to biological hazards, bacteria, and communicable diseases; may require districtwidetravelMental Demands: Work with frequent interruptions; maintain emotional control under pressure
